A FORDINGBRIDGE church is going to be opening its doors to serve up free warm lunches to help those struggling with the cost of living crisis.

The Catholic Church of Our Lady of Sorrows and Saint Philip Benizi is launching the initiative from Thursday, November 3.

The lunches are intended to help anyone who is struggling to deal with the energy price rises or the ever rising cost of food or is just lonely and would like a little company.

Those interested in coming along can turn up at the church hall on Salisbury Street at around 11am and are welcome to stay until just after 3pm.

The church hall will serve up tea and coffee with a lunch of soup and bread.

There is no charge and it is open to everyone. The warm lunches will be served every Thursday.
